I sunday I was on track in Thompson OH, weather was 80F
I have installed BBK pulleys and FRP alu driveshaft two weeks ago , and on track first run I run
14.137@97 with 1.94 60ft
Back up run was 14.124@97 with 1.97 60ft
third run I swich lane drop pressure from 24 to 22psi and run 14.2@96 with 2.0 60ft
Thing is two months ago I run 14.7@93 without pulleys and driveshaft and now 14.1 , I think 13 coming very sone in 3800lb car with stock long block
